Teresa Valor holds a degree in Forestry Engineering from the Universitat Politècnica de València and a PhD in Terrestrial Ecology from the Universitat Autònoma de Barcelona. She is currently a lecturer at the School of Agri-Food and Biosystems Engineering (EEABB) at Polytechnic University of Catalonia, where she teaches in the Landscape Architecture grade. Her research focuses on forest resilience, investigating how trees respond to disturbances such as wildfires, bark beetles, and drought using methodologies like dendrochronology, isotopic analysis, and terpene quantification. Recently, she has expanded her work to explore how species interactions vary along environmental gradients.
